personaly i really like eggbeaters, my knees are shagged and the way eggs work is they don't 'want' to center them self so it never feels like you fighting the float (i found that with shimanos), they also rule in mud.

only problem is they are useless if your not cliped in and some people have reported that they cause some funky wear above your cleats.

I WOULD GO TIME ATAC. I HAVE HAD TWO PAIRS ON TWO BIKES FOR THE LAST 4 YEARS. I RECENTLY TRIED THEIR PLATFORM PEDAL (NAME?) AWESOME SUPPORT AROUND THE CLEAT, I WILL BE GETTING THEM NEXT FOR TRAIL RIDING AND PUTTING NEW ATACS ON FOR RACING.

EGG BEATERS ARE A GREAT DESIGN BUT YOU NEED A VERY STIFF SOLED SHOE OTHERWISE YOU WILL END UP GETTING STRESS FRACTURES IN YOU FOOT FROM THE SMALL SUPPORT AREA OF THE PEDAL. IT IS REALLY ONLY A RACE PEDAL.
